Fees

Check the accreditation of any lawyer you employ to represent your VA disability claim. To be an accredited representative, an attorney has to meet certain requirements including having experience and education in veterans law. Additionally, they are not allowed to charge more than 20% of past-due benefits to represent you before the VA. Any cost that is greater than this must be substantiated by convincing and clear proof that it isn't reasonable.

Appeals

When the VA refuses disability benefits or assigns a lower rating than what you are entitled to, an attorney can help file an appeal. There are a variety of methods to appeal a decision, and each requires a distinct time. An attorney can explain the process in plain language and help you decide which option is the most suitable for [empty] your situation.

The simplest way to appeal a rating decision is to request a review at a higher level from a senior adjudicator. This lane requires a thorough examination of the evidence supporting your claim. It is not possible to submit any new evidence.

You may also submit an additional claim if you have relevant new evidence to back up your claim. This section lets you provide any evidence that is not medical and did not appear on your original application. This includes lay statements, which are sworn testimonials from people who are aware of the effects of your condition on you.

In the end, you can request direct review from the Board of Veterans' Appeals in Washington, D.C. This is the best chance of success but is also the most challenging and time-consuming.
